Description
Key Features
Academic insights from Springer, a trusted name in scientific publishing and biological research literature.
Explores the taxonomic relationship between Crustacea and insects to clarify classification methods.
Provides a deep dive into the biological importance and study of one of the most significant animal groups.
Suitable for undergraduate students and researchers studying animal sciences and habitats.
Offers a scholarly perspective on why Crustacea remain a central focus in modern biological studies.
